All-in-one solution for WiMAX mobile station production: R&S CMW270 When it comes to measurement speed, the new R&S CMW270 WiMAX tester is up to ten times faster than existing test solutions. The result is maximum throughput in the production of WiMAX chipsets and mobile stations. Measurement accuracy is also optimized with respect to stability and linearity, thus providing maximum repeatability. The R&S CMW270 combines signal generation and analysis in one instrument. Three calibrated RF connectors in the RF frontend reduce typically complex test setups, thus saving cost, time, and space in production and service. Spectrum analysis for mobile radio and wideband communications: R&S FSG The R&S FSG is a spectrum analyzer for cost-conscious users, tailored to needs specific to the development and production of wireless communications products. It supports 2G and 3G mobile radio standards as well as current wideband technologies such as WiMAX and WLAN. Its demodulation bandwidth of 28 MHz also makes it a future-proof investment in the next generation of mobile radio – UMTS LTE. High dynamic range, a frequency range up to 13.6 GHz, and integrated vector signal analysis also make the R&S FSG a powerful tool for the general analysis of digitally modulated signals. Analog signals up to 6 GHz: R&S SMB100A When a signal source is needed, high signal quality, wide flexibility, and low operating costs are primary considerations. This also holds true in the mid-range class – whether for mobile radio, broadcasting, aerospace & defense or EMC. With these requirements in mind, Rohde & Schwarz has developed the new R&S SMB100A analog signal generator, which has a frequency range of 9 kHz to 6 GHz. The standard-setting generator offers low single sideband (SSB) phase noise of typ. –128 dBc and an output level of >+18 dBm over a wide frequency range of 1 MHz to 6 GHz – a world first in this class. Purest signals for mobile radio/radar applications: R&S SMF100A By introducing the new R&S SMF100A analog microwave signal generator, Rohde & Schwarz is setting new standards in single sideband (SSB) phase noise. The signal generator features a unique value of –115 dBc (at 10 GHz/10 kHz offset), making it ideal for a wide range of telecommunications and radar applications. In addition, its high output power of typ. +25 dBm at 20 GHz and extremely short setting times for frequency and level make the R&S SMF100A the ideal instrument for production. Moreover, the signal generator covers the frequency range of 100 kHz to 43.5 GHz. Compact and cost-efficient for all current standards: R&S SFE The R&S SFE broadcast tester is a signal generator for analog and digital TV and numerous sound broadcasting standards. Up to three standards can be installed simultaneously. The R&S SFE combines an RF modulator, a universal realtime coder, and baseband signal sources in one instrument. It can thus generate broadcast signals in the frequency range of 100 kHz to 2.5 GHz in realtime. Its modular design means that it can easily be adapted to various requirements in the lab, in service, and in production.
